    Superluminal travel would be interesting, though its possible it might not make a big difference from a technical standpoint. For example, assuming Einstein is still right, you are limited by c but thanks to time dilation (at highly relativistic speeds), the traveler would experience less time passage (or shorter distance). This is the same thing as simply traveling faster than light with no time dilation, and would probably require similar amounts of energy.

          Don’t let the peanut gallery get you down. I remember not too long ago when scientists finally concluded that neutrinos actually did have mass. My high school and college textbooks didn’t even mention the possibility that neutrinos had mass, so that tells you how fundamental knowledge is subject to change.
